Which fast food restaurants started serving breakfast first in America?

A. McDonald's

B. Jack in the box

C. Wendy's

D. Taco Bell 

B. Jack in the box

Jack in the Box was the first true quick-service restaurant to introduce a breakfast sandwich back in 1969. However, McDonald's officially launched its breakfast menu in 1972. Wendy's also launched its breakfast menu in 2020 as part of a brand revitalization initiative3

In which country did the breakfast dish of eggs benedict originate?

A. France

B. Germany 

C. Mexico 

D. United States 

D. United States 

Eggs Benedict is believed to have originated in the United States, specifically in New York City123. The dish was created in the late 1800s by a retired Wall Street broker who ordered a unique combination of ingredients at a local restaurant.
